Reviewer 1 Report

The manuscript describes initial work on the identification of anthracnose causative agent in sword beans as observed in the Yunnan province, China. The species causing leaf and stem spots was verified as C. truncatum by using sequence analysis of the ITS, ACT, GAPDH, and HIS3 genes. This was used to complement morphological and cultural characterization to identify this Colletotrichum species.

The manuscript is written well, with clear experimental logic and appropriate methodology applied to both pathogenicity assay and molecular characterization.

1 There is some information that authors need to add, for example, alongside with ITS gene, why did authors choose ACT, gapdh, and HIS3 genes for multiple DNA sequencing?

Response: It was described that single gene ITS cannot clearly distinguish between C. lentis and C. truncatum (Xu, 2017), phylogenetic analyses based on the combination of ITS, ACT, HIS3, and GAPDH sequences clearly distinguished C. truncatum from the other closely related Colletotrichum species and described in the text.

2 The authors mentioned in lines 161 and 174 that “3) the fungus was subsequently re-isolated”, where is the evidence of the re-isolated strain, for example, colony morphology or DNA sequencing?

Response: The re-isolated strain from the inoculated plants identified as C. truncatum by colony morphology and was consistent with that previously described in Figure 2.
